在进入区块链数据的组成成分之前,我们首先需要了解一下区块链是什么。区块链是一种去中心化的数字账本技术,广泛应用于加密货币、供应链管理、智能合约等多个领域。它的核心特征是安全性和透明度,每一笔交易的记录都通过网络中的每个节点共同验证,确保数据的真实性。
区块链中的数据主要由若干个“区块”组成,而每个区块又包含了一系列关键的信息。下面是一些主要的组成成分:
交易数据是区块链的核心部分。这部分数据记录了资产的转移,比如比特币从一个钱包转移到另一个钱包。每笔交易通常包括发送者和接收者的地址、转账金额以及时间戳等信息。交易数据不仅可以是货币的转移,还可以是智能合约中执行的具体操作。
每个区块都有一个“区块头”,它包含了很多重要的元数据。区块头通常包括以下几个方面的信息:前一个区块的哈希值、当前区块的时间戳、交易的默克尔树根(Merkle Root)等。这些信息确保了区块与区块之间的链接,维持整个区块链的完整性。
哈希值是区块链数据安全的关键。每个区块通过哈希算法生成一个唯一的哈希值,这个值是区块内容的“指纹”。任何对区块内容的更改都会导致哈希值的变化,因此哈希值能有效地防止数据被篡改,从而保证了数据的安全性。
区块链最大的特点就是去中心化。传统的数据库通常是集中管理的,由一个中心化的服务器进行维护,而区块链则把数据保存在整个网络中,每个参与节点都有一份完整的数据副本。这种结构使得数据更加可靠,因为即使某个节点出现故障,其他节点仍然可以保证数据不丢失。
区块链也是一种公开透明的数据存储方式。所有的交易和区块信息对参与者都是可见的,任何人都可以通过区块链浏览器查阅交易记录。这种透明性不仅提高了信任度,还为审计和合规提供了便利。
由于区块链的数据一旦写入后就几乎不可能被更改,这使得其具有不可篡改性。每一笔交易都经过 cryptographic 哈希算法处理,确保一旦信息被录入,任何试图进行修改的行为都会导致整个区块链的链断开,从而被迅速检测出来。
区块链数据的优势使其在许多领域都找到了应用场景:
区块链最初和最著名的应用是比特币和其他加密货币。这些数字资产通过区块链技术实现透明、安全的交易,消除了传统金融中存在的中介成本。
智能合约是一种基于区块链技术的自动化合约。它可以在条件满足时自动执行某个操作,大大提高了交易的效率和可靠性。
区块链在供应链中的应用能够实时跟踪产品的流通,从原材料到消费者手中都可以在区块链上公开追溯,确保产品的来源和真实性。
区块链的数据安全性主要依赖于加密技术和共识机制。通过这些技术,区块链能够抵御各种网络攻击,比如双重支付、DDoS攻击等。同时,去中心化的结构也增加了数据被篡改的难度,因为要想攻击整个网络,需要对大多数节点进行控制,几乎是不可能的。
随着技术的发展,区块链数据的应用将逐渐扩展到更多的领域,包括医疗、房地产、投票系统等。同时,随着全球各国监管政策的逐步明确,区块链将向着更加规范化、标准化的方向发展。此外,跨链技术的发展将促进不同区块链之间的互联互通,使得区块链的应用场景更加多元化。
总的来说,区块链数据的组成成分包括交易数据、区块头信息、哈希值等,而其去中心化、透明性和不可篡改性也是其理想数据存储解决方案的重要特征。随着技术的日益成熟,区块链势必会在更多领域扮演重要角色,值得我们持续关注和探索。
2003-2025 2025TP钱包官网下载 @版权所有|网站地图|